Output 30d6def9abcb999186a802a7de261d3856fbb5f045c51e92495c75d06afbf036:2

value
742797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 617c950666b7df412899ca60b76fce7f4ce35bb6 OP_EQUAL
address
3AaUiGaRnwkcY3oDVNmzEyRxPxu5wLDjUX
transaction
30d6def9abcb999186a802a7de261d3856fbb5f045c51e92495c75d06afbf036
spent
true